Your speedometer will read about 13% high at all speeds (3.08/2.73 = 1.128).   Mike - Original Message - From: [EMAIL PROTECTED] To: [EMAIL PROTECTED] Sent: Thursday, May 09, 2002 10:05 PM Subject: [Chevelle-List] Rear End Question Greetings Gang,Just

Title: Message Your speedo will be off by ~10%, assuming it was accurate before.  Your car thinks you have 2.73 gears, but the wheels are actually spinning a bit faster with 3.08 gears.  When your speedometer says 60, you will likely be going ~53 mph.   You can test it by checking the odome
